Why Saint Paul Drivers Choose Mobile Brake Repair Instead of Waiting at a Shop (St. Paul)

 

For most drivers, brake problems do not happen at a convenient time. The squeal starts before work. The grinding shows up on a day packed with errands. The pedal feels soft right when you have no room in your schedule to sit at a repair shop for half a day. That is exactly why mobile brake service has become such a practical option for people around Saint Paul.

Traditional shops still have their place, but they also come with friction. You have to arrange your day around the appointment, find a ride if the vehicle needs to stay, wait in line behind other jobs, and hope communication stays clear. With a mobile mechanic, the value is simpler. The repair comes to you. That means you can get help at home, at work, or wherever the vehicle is safely parked without building your whole day around a shop visit.

The real advantage is not just convenience. It is speed and decision-making. When a driver starts looking for a mobile brake repair in St. Paul, the issue is usually already affecting confidence in the vehicle. The brakes may be squealing, vibrating, grinding, or taking longer to stop. Those are not symptoms most people want to gamble with for another week. Being able to get a mechanic to the vehicle quickly helps the owner move from stress to action without extra delay.

Brake repairs are also the kind of job where honest communication matters. A lot of people worry that once they walk into a shop they will hear a long list of add-ons they did not expect. The mobile model tends to feel more direct. The mechanic is standing at the vehicle with the customer nearby, explaining what is worn, what needs immediate attention, and what can wait. That clarity builds trust fast, especially for people who have had poor experiences elsewhere.

For Saint Paul drivers, there is another practical angle: weather and routine. When the roads are rough, the schedule is full, and the vehicle is already acting up, the easiest plan usually wins. Mobile brake service removes towing in many cases, eliminates waiting room time, and shortens the gap between noticing a problem and doing something about it. That is a real benefit, not just a marketing line.

If your brakes are making noise, shaking, or no longer feeling solid, the smartest move is to address it before the repair gets larger and the risk gets higher. Mobile service makes that step easier. Instead of hoping the problem stays manageable, you can bring the repair to your driveway, job site, or parking lot and get the vehicle looked at where it already is.
